About DIAMINES & CHEMICALS LTD.-$

Diamines and Chemicals Limited manufactures and sells organic chemical compounds in India. The company's products include piperazine anhydrous, ethylenediamine, diethylenetriamine, aminoethylpiperazine, triethylenetetramine, tetraethylenepentamine, polyethylene polyamine-mix, monoethanol amine, triethylenediamine, diaminopropane, dipropylene triamine, diacetyl ethylenediamine, tetracetyl ethylenediamine, tetra methyl ethylenediamine, and amine mixture, as well as piperazine derivatives. It exports its chemical products. The company was incorporated in 1976 and is based in Vadodara, India.

  • Leading volatility indicator
  • Can be used to determine stop-loss positions
  • Calculated by:
    • Current high minus the current low
    • Current high minus the previous close
    • Current low minus the previous close
  • The larger the range of the candles, the greater the ATR value

5.1 On-Balance Volume (OBV)

 Measures market volatility

  • Leading momentum indicator
  • Calculation:
    • If the closing price is above the previous closing price: OBV = previous OBV + current volume
    • If the closing price is below the previous closing price: OBV = previous OBV - current volume
    • If the closing price is the same as the previous closing price than the OBV is the same.
  • Can be used to confirm price trends
  • Can be used with divergences
